About Oliver Schmelz
Oliver Schmelz is a scholar working on Inorganic Chemistry, Oncology and Materials Chemistry, having authored 7 papers that have together received 379 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(4 papers), Metal complexes synthesis and properties (3 papers) and Oxidative Organic Chemistry Reactions (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Materials Chemistry (283 citations), Biophysics (26 citations) and Organic Chemistry (126 citations). Oliver Schmelz has collaborated with scholars based in Germany. Frequent co-authors include Kläus Müllen, Alf Mews, Thomas Basché, Andreas Herrmann, P.T. Herwig, Volker Enkelmann, Matthias Rehahn, Gunnar Jeschke, Dariush Hinderberger and Steffen Kelch. Their work appears in journals such as Angewandte Chemie International Edition, Langmuir and Chemistry - A European Journal.
